An Eye for an Eye: Understanding the Dangers of Revenge
The correct proverb is "An eye for an eye and a tooth for a tooth would make the whole world blind and toothless."
This proverb warns against the dangers of revenge and retaliation, suggesting that if everyone seeks revenge for every wrong done to them, it would lead to a never-ending cycle of violence and destruction, leaving everyone worse off in the end.
